Draft Ike!

On February 8 in 1952, close to 25,000 people assembled at New York City’s Madison Square Garden rallying around Dwight Eisenhower’s political aspirations. This event was an extension of the “Draft Ike” movement, which had been appearing on both Democratic and Republican lines across the nation since the 1948 election.
